Meet Kokos

His story is sadly all too common. He simply got in someone’s way — and they decided to get rid of him, in the cruelest way possible.

For three long days (maybe more), he just lay there, unable to move. He couldn’t defend himself when other animals attacked him. Under the hot sun, his wounds began to rot and fill with maggots. He didn’t even cry... he simply couldn’t.

Veterinarians spent a long time trying to figure out what was wrong. Eventually, they discovered he had been poisoned with arsenic.

Arsenic causes severe weakness, intense pain, and often death within hours. Kokos was incredibly lucky — he was rescued just in time.

Now he’s safe in paid foster care.
He’s neutered, vaccinated, dewormed, and ready to find his forever family! 💛

Kokos is around 1.5–2 years old — a big-hearted, gentle boy. Despite his size, he gets along perfectly with other animals and children.
He doesn’t bark without reason and seems to understand everything without words.

If you’re looking for a loyal, kind-hearted friend — Kokos might just be the perfect one. 😍

A Child from a Catalog or Surrogacy: The Ethics of Choice

Thousands of years ago, humanity discovered a simple truth: what you don’t have, you can trade for. If you had an abundance of potatoes, you could exchange them for coffee, for example. In this way, basic needs and desires were met.

But as society evolved, so did the nature of our desires. And often, the higher the social status, the more extravagant—or even troubling—those desires became. From rare delicacies to, in darker moments of history, the ownership of other human beings. But let’s focus on something more relatable—modern-day consumerism and status.

In a world full of stereotypes and social pressures, many people forget that each of us is inherently unique. Yet, we often feel the need to stand out or to follow trends—whether it’s through fashion, lifestyle, or even the kind of pet we choose.

It’s become common for people to spend thousands of dollars on “designer” pets—purebred cats and dogs chosen from websites as if from a catalog. These animals don’t plow fields or herd livestock. They sit on couches, wear bows, and serve as living accessories. Or worse, they’re bred to be intimidating guard dogs, but when they don’t meet breed standards—perhaps a tail is slightly off—they’re deemed unsellable and abandoned.

The breeding industry often treats animals like machines—expected to reproduce on schedule to turn a profit. Once they’re no longer "useful," many are discarded without a second thought.

That’s when volunteers step in. These unsung heroes rescue and rehabilitate animals, doing their best to find them loving, permanent homes. But not all of these stories have happy endings.

The more we treat living beings as products, the more suffering we create. So before you support a breeder or search for the “perfect” pet, ask yourself—are you feeding your ego or making a compassionate choice?

Adopt. Don’t shop. Give a home to an animal who truly needs it.

What Makes a Dog Different from a Human?

Loyalty. No matter how poorly a human treats an animal, a dog will still love them—unconditionally.

When you rescue a dog from the streets, you can't explain to them why they were abandoned or left behind. But you can help them, offering the care and love they so desperately need.

You feed them, provide medical attention, groom them, and begin searching for the right family. But sometimes, a dog chooses their own family. That’s exactly what happened with Tosha.

After arriving, he stayed with Natalia, one of the volunteers in our rescue organization. Many families came to meet him, but he never truly connected with anyone.

Time passed, and we finally thought we had found the perfect home—a spacious backyard, a kind elderly couple. Tosha was brought to their home in the morning. But by the next morning, he was gone!

Our entire team immediately launched a search. We set up a small camp, hoping he would return for food. We caught glimpses of his tail in the bushes, but his trust had been broken, and he was too afraid to come near a group of people.

Then, something incredible happened. As soon as everyone stepped away and left Natalia alone, Tosha ran straight to her, leaping into her arms with joy.

And just like that, he found his forever home—becoming the fifth beloved dog in her care. ❤️
